A Brief History of Microphone Gaffes
The Reverend Jesse Jackson might be the latest public figure to forget about his mic, but he's certainly not the first. Here, TIME presents the top 10 most memorable microphone gaffes.
M.J. Stephey
Jesse Jackson's Graphic Threat
While taping an interview for Fox News on Sunday, the Reverend Jesse Jackson whispered to a fellow guest that he wants to "cut the nuts off" of Sen. Barack Obama for "talking down to black people." Even before Fox's Bill O'Reilly aired the footage, Jackson issued an apology for his "crude" remarks, saying his support for Obama is unequivocal: "It was very private. And very much a sound bite."
